150 Hamakua Dr, Kailua, HI 96734
Kailua Mini Self Storage is a self storage facility in Kailua, HI located at 150 Hamakua Dr, Kailua, HI 96734. Kailua Mini Self Storage offers affordable, convenient self storage units in Kailua, HI.